Implement the 'Sensor Interpreter' and 'Risk Assessor' agents using Langroid with ReAct patterns. The Sensor Interpreter should use MCP tools to access simulated sensor data (e.g., 'get_lidar_readings', 'analyze_camera_feed') and use OpenAI o3 for quick interpretations. The Risk Assessor should receive these interpretations, query Haystack for relevant safety protocols, and use Claude Opus 4.1 for deeper reasoning to identify hazards and potential risks.
